LIRIK Faces Backlash After Announcing NFT Collection

Streamer LIRIK Announces Plans to Release NFT Collection

Popular Twitch streamer LIRIK recently revealed his intention to release a collection of NFTs on the Ethereum blockchain during a livestream. However, this news has divided his audience, sparking both excitement and criticism.

NFT Collection Clarifications

LIRIK made it clear that he is not partnering with any clip-related NFT sites like MyClipsTV, which recently shut down due to copyright issues. However, some viewers accused him of a scam. LIRIK promptly denied these allegations and explained his plans to sell the NFTs directly on his website.

Price Points and Comparisons

LIRIK revealed that he will mint 10,000 NFTs for his upcoming release, with each one priced at $50. He compared this price point to buying a shirt from a merchandise store, emphasizing its affordability.

Backlash Prompts Rethinking of NFT Plans

The intense backlash LIRIK received for his NFT collection has led him to reconsider his plans. He expressed surprise at the negative response and acknowledged the controversy surrounding NFTs.

Understanding NFTs and Their Significance

NFTs are unique tokens that exist on a blockchain, such as Ethereum, and are verified by digital “smart contracts.” These tokens allow digital art enthusiasts to authenticate their purchases and differentiate them from other similar works. In essence, NFTs provide a way to prove the authenticity of digital images.
